Windows Defender: Comprehensive Malware Protection in Windows
Windows Defender, also termed Microsoft Defender Antivirus is an embedded antivirus and anti-malware solution from Microsoft, provided as a native feature in Windows 10 and Windows 11. It is key to the ongoing protection and security of your computer. Playing a role in preventing threats such as viruses, spyware, rootkits, and other malicious software.
